Bridgwater & Taunton College Trust seeks enthusiastic Primary Teachers for maternity cover at Brookside Primary Academy in Street, Somerset. Join a nurturing environment focusing on inclusivity and high expectations, working with children aged 0-11.
Deliver engaging lessons across KS1 and KS2, assess pupil progress, and contribute to the school's wider life. Candidates should hold Qualified Teacher Status and have experience in primary education.
A range of benefits including Teachers' Pension Scheme and wellbeing support are offered.

How to prepare for a job interview at Bridgwater & Taunton College Trust
✨Know Your Curriculum
Make sure you’re well-versed in the KS1 and KS2 curriculum. Familiarise yourself with the key subjects and learning objectives, as this will help you demonstrate your understanding of what’s expected in the classroom.
✨Showcase Your Passion for Inclusivity
Since the role focuses on inclusivity, be ready to share examples of how you've adapted lessons for diverse learners. Discuss strategies you've used to engage all students, ensuring everyone feels valued and included.
✨Prepare Engaging Lesson Ideas
Think of a few creative lesson ideas that you could present during the interview. This shows your enthusiasm and ability to deliver engaging content, which is crucial for keeping young learners interested.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ions about the school’s approach to teaching and learning. This not only shows your interest in the role but also helps you gauge if the school’s values align with yours.
